Dedicated County road right-of-way shall be restored with <br />solid sod if disturbed during construction. <br />M. Bridges. All bridges shall: <br />1) be designed in general accordance with the current <br />standards and practices of the Department of <br />Transportation <br />2) be designed for Department of Transportation's <br />H -20-S16-44 loading standard <br />3) be constructed of reinforced concrete. Other low <br />maintenance materials may be used if approved by the <br />Public Works Director and the Board of County <br />Commissioners. <br />4) include provisions for utility installation <br />5) have a clear road width, between curbs, of two (2) <br />feet on each side in excess of the pavement width <br />6) include a continuation of the sidewalk -bikeway plan <br />established for the right-of-way <br />7) include adequate erosion protection. <br />N.
